1,2,4-Pyrrolidinetricarboxylic acid,4-(2E)-2-hexenyl-3,5-dioxo-2-(phenylmethyl)-, 1-(1,1-dimethylethyl)2-ethyl 4-(phenylmethyl) ester

HOME PAGE

CAS No: 873567-00-1

873567-00-1
Order 873567-00-1
pyrrolidinetricarboxylic,hexenyl,dioxo,phenylmethyl,dimethylethyl,ethyl,ester